Course Content

• Constructing Masculinity: Historical and Cultural Perspectives
• Hegemonic Masculinity and its Impacts
• Masculinity, Power, and Privilege: Exploring Social Dynamics
• Understanding Toxic Masculinity and its Manifestations
• Challenging Traditional Gender Roles and Stereotypes
• Masculinity and Mental Health: Addressing Wellbeing
• Masculinity in Relationships: Intimacy and Communication
• Intersectionality and Masculinity: Exploring Race, Class, and Sexuality
• Redefining Masculinity: Towards Healthy and Equitable Models
• Masculinity and Social Change: Advocacy and Activism
